24,043 Steps to Miles, By Height

The 2,000-steps-per-mile figure above is a flat average. Stride length actually scales with height, so the same 24,043 steps covers a different distance depending on how tall the walker is.

HeightDistance
Short (~5'2")9.74 mi
Average (~5'7")10.53 mi
Tall (~6'2")11.63 mi

Where 24,043 Steps Ranks

Activity levels are commonly grouped by daily step count. Here's where 24,043 steps falls.

Activity LevelDaily Steps
SedentaryUnder 5,000
Low Active5,000–7,499
Somewhat Active7,500–9,999
Active10,000–12,499
Highly Active12,500+

If you suddenly need to step over or around something in your path, your legs can adjust mid-stride in about 120 milliseconds, faster than you can consciously register you've seen the obstacle. That's your nervous system's fast, subconscious pathways doing the work.

At its peak, the Roman road network stretched over 250,000 miles, with stone milestones planted every thousand paces so army commanders could calculate march times. It's one of the earliest large-scale uses of a standardized steps-to-distance conversion.
